Repointing services involve the careful process of removing deteriorated or damaged mortar from between bricks or stones and replacing it with fresh, durable mortar. This work helps restore the structural integrity and appearance of masonry surfaces, ensuring that the building remains stable and protected from the elements. Repointing is a precise task that requires skill to match the existing mortar’s color and texture, helping to maintain the property's original aesthetic. By addressing the mortar joints, homeowners can prevent further deterioration that might lead to more costly repairs down the line.

Many common problems can signal the need for repointing services. Cracks or gaps in the mortar joints are often visible signs, especially after harsh weather or settling of the foundation. Moisture infiltration through damaged mortar can cause bricks or stones to loosen, leading to potential structural issues or water damage inside the property. Additionally, crumbling or crumbling mortar can diminish curb appeal and reduce the overall value of a home. Addressing these issues early with professional repointing can help prevent more extensive repairs and extend the lifespan of a masonry structure.

The overview below groups typical Repointing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wilmington, DE.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Repointing minor cracks or small areas typically costs between $250 and $600 for many routine jobs.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ly within this range, which covers basic repairs on residential properties. Larger or more complex repairs may push costs higher but are less common in this category.

Standard Repointing - For most standard repointing projects on brick or masonry facades, the typical cost ranges from $1,000 to $3,500. These projects often involve replacing or repairing mortar joints on medium-sized walls or sections of a home. Many projects fall within this middle range, with fewer reaching into higher tiers.

Full Wall or Extensive Repointing - When repointing entire sections or larger walls, costs can range from $4,000 to $8,000 depending on size and complexity. These projects are common for older homes needing comprehensive work, though they represent a smaller portion of overall jobs due to their scale.

Complete Masonry Replacement - Larger, more complex projects such as full masonry replacements or structural repairs can exceed $10,000 and may reach $20,000+ for very extensive work.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ve significant structural considerations or historic restoration efforts.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is repointing and why is it needed? Repointing involves renewing the mortar joints between bricks or stones to improve structural integrity and prevent water intrusion, especially in older buildings around Wilmington, DE.

How can I tell if my property needs repointing services? Signs include crumbling or cracked mortar, gaps between bricks, or visible deterioration on exterior walls, which may indicate the need for professional repointing.

What types of materials are used in repointing? Common materials include traditional lime mortar and modern cement-based mixes, chosen based on the age and style of the building and local climate conditions.

Are there different techniques for repointing existing masonry? Yes, techniques vary from hand tooling to machine-guided methods, depending on the structure’s requirements and accessibility, to ensure proper mortar application.
